| Core Tip |
Dyslipidemia has emerged as a leading modifiable risk factor for atherosclerotic, cardiovascular and hepatic diseases. Gut microbiota lipid metabolism interactions offer new opportunities for dyslipidemia management, but translating these insights into clinical practice requires more than compositional profiling. This letter emphasizes overlooked dimensions like circadian rhythm alignment, drug-microbe crosstalk, population-specific microbial patterns, and functional microbial signatures to guide precision, context-aware strategies for cardiovascular risk reduction. |
